Table 1 The simulation of hypotension of advanced life support in the operationroom

From: Simulation of operating room crisis management - hypotension training for pre‐clinical students

  1. Remarks: Crisis Management Points-score 2 points for 100% completed, 1 point for more than 50%, 0.5 point for less than 50%, and 0 point for zero completed
  2. Nontechnical skills- score 1 point for a perfect completed, score 0.5 point for a partially completed, and 0 point for zero completed
